Jenkins流程:
1. 开发者提交代码到版本控制系统。 2. Jenkins触发构建任务。 3. Jenkins检出代码。 4. Jenkins执行构建脚本,如Maven、Shell等。 5. 构建成功后,Jenkins进行自动化测试。 6. 测试通过,Jenkins将构建产物打包。 7. Jenkins部署到测试环境或生产环境。 8. 构建记录和通知。
实操提醒:确保Jenkins配置正确,避免构建失败。
Jenkins自动化部署流程:
- 开发者提交代码到版本控制(如Git)。
- Jenkins定时或触发器检测到代码变更。
- Jenkins拉取最新代码到本地工作区。
- Jenkins执行构建脚本(如Maven、Shell等)。
- 构建成功后,Jenkins打包应用。
- Jenkins将打包的应用部署到服务器。
- 部署完成后,Jenkins发送通知给相关人员。 实操提醒:确保Jenkins与版本控制系统正确配置,避免部署失败。